This book, just the like the four others in the series, was amazing. It took a minute to get into but when you did it was so good, I couldn’t put it down. 
But that being said, this is the worst book in the series. It took me the longest to read and that was mostly because of pacing issues. This book is a lot slower than the others. There is also three point of views so it gets very confusing at parts. 
But my favourite part of this book was learning about Juliette’s backstory. This was so interesting and done in such a good way. It was one of the best things this book did. And it even made me like Juliette/Ella better.

In conclusion, 
Other than a few problems this book was amazing. I would recommend.
